What are the implications of Voyager going bankrupt for the cryptocurrency industry?

What would be the potential consequences for the cryptocurrency industry if Voyager, a prominent digital currency exchange, were to go bankrupt?

- INDRAJ VMay 11, 2022 · 4 years agoIf Voyager were to go bankrupt, it would likely have a significant impact on the cryptocurrency industry. As one of the major exchanges, Voyager's bankruptcy could lead to a loss of trust and confidence in the industry as a whole. Investors may become more cautious and hesitant to invest in cryptocurrencies, leading to a decrease in trading volume and liquidity. Additionally, the bankruptcy could result in a loss of funds for users who have their assets stored on the platform. This could further erode trust in the industry and potentially lead to increased regulatory scrutiny. Overall, the implications of Voyager going bankrupt would be far-reaching and could potentially disrupt the cryptocurrency market.
